Overview

Hurricane Beryl made landfall on the southeastern coast of Texas early Monday morning as a Category 1 storm, packing maximum sustained winds of 75 mph. The storm’s center was located about 45 miles north-northeast of Matagorda, Texas, and about 40 miles southwest of Houston. It is moving north at approximately 12 mph, bringing dangerous storm surge, flash flooding, and strong winds to the region. 

Beryl initially strengthened to a Category 5 hurricane, setting a record for the earliest Category 5 hurricane in the Atlantic. However, it weakened significantly before making landfall in Texas. Despite this weakening, the storm has caused significant impacts, including the potential for up to 15 inches of rainfall in some areas, power outages, and severe flooding. Evacuations and precautionary measures have been implemented across Texas to mitigate the storm’s impact. 

Beryl also made significant impacts as it moved through the Caribbean and towards Mexico and the southern United States. After causing severe damage and 10 fatalities in Jamaica and the Cayman Islands, Beryl made landfall on Mexico’s Yucatán Peninsula as a Category 2 hurricane, bringing strong winds and heavy rainfall to areas like Tulum and Cancun.

A part of monitoring during this time is through Rx Open. Rx Open provides information on the operating status of healthcare facilities in areas impacted by a disaster. When the map is active for an event, users can use the Facilities map to search for individual facility status such as pharmacies, community health centers, and dialysis centers.

About Healthcare Ready

Healthcare Ready is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that works to ensure patient access to healthcare in times of disaster, emergency, and disease outbreaks. We leverage unique relationships with government, nonprofit and medical supply chains to build and enhance the resiliency of communities before, during and after disasters. Learn more about Healthcare Ready
